Job Summary
CES, Inc is seeking Optometrists who are licensed to practice in Hawaii to evaluate patients who are applying for benefits due to visual impairments. The provider will ONLY be doing evaluations and not treating patients. There is no follow up, no prescribing, no on-call. We work around your schedule.
Responsibilities and Duties
Provider will evaluate patients who are referred by our clients. The examinees will be evaluated in your office and a full optometry exam will be performed. The Provider will provide a narrative report and provide an opinion as to any visual impairments and how they impact the examinee's ADLs and any work ability.
These are NOT workers compensation evaluations. The Provider does NOT decide whether a patient has a disability or not. The Provider does not decide or recommend whether or not the examinee qualifies or should get benefits. This is an administrative decision that our clients will make with the help of your report. The Provider only gives an opinion of the examinee's impairment-related restrictions due to visual deficits.
